多个Thunk调度是同步执行还是异步执行?

时间:2019-12-22 09:49:58

标签: reactjs react-native redux redux-thunk

如果我有3个或4个Thunk方法,每个方法都有自己的API请求。我这样称呼他们:

const someDummyThunkMethod = () => {
  return async (dispatch: ThunkDispatch<{}, {}, any>) => {

  dispatch(myFirstThunkWithAPICall());
  dispatch(mySecondThunkWithAPICall());
  dispatch(myThirdThunkWithAPICall());
  dispatch(myFourthThunkWithAPICall());
  }
}

所有4个请求会并行还是按顺序执行?

1 个答案:

答案 0 :(得分:0)

同时,因为您没有await对其进行编辑。但是它们确实按该顺序发送出去。